If ever a player likes to play "with the sun on his back" ... it is Mark Viduka. You ask Boro fans how often the Oz striker was in the treatment room at the Riverside during the cold snap.
However, Viduka has made his long awaited return to training at Newcastle United.
The striker has not kicked a ball for the club since May because of a niggling Achilles problem, but first-team coach Chris Hughton has revealed he could be back in action in a fortnight.
Hughton: "Mark's been out for a while with an Achilles problem and he has been going through the rehab process.
"
Today was the first time he has trained with the group, but with regards to getting him back in a Newcastle shirt, we are not sure yet.
"Hopefully, he will be involved over the next two or three weeks, but the problem with any timescale is that the player has been out for a while and we have to be careful with him.
"For the moment, it is day to day."
